Free Blackberry Theme for 9700: pure.system ii
pure.system ii now updated to be compatible with OS 5 and the new Blackberry Bold 9700.
Introducing the system that we should have on our blackberry:
pure.system II
- Wallpaper friendly
- Speedy and sleek
- clock, connections and profile icons on home screen
- 3 user customizable slots
- with hidden today
- Supports International Characters
- Triangle button launches music player
- space bar launch ShortcutMe or QuickLaunch
- Transitions between screens
- User definable font size
- Place weather app on first slot for weather slot version

Yeah, UMA is T-Mobile's service to use wifi for unlicensed mobile access, so you can use HotSpots to make phone calls over wifi networks. I've included a screenshot so you can see what I'm talking about.
